When automotive manufacturers decide where to put a gas tank, “ next to the rear bumper” isn’t a good choice. If that sounds like an obvious problem – well, it is. ![]() The 1993-2004 Jeep Grand Cherokees, 1993-2001 Jeep Cherokees, and 2002-2007 Jeep Liberties all share the same defect – the gas tank is right next to the rear bumper. The Jeep burns and often explodes, and if someone inside the Jeep isn’t able to get out, the consequences are horrible. ![]() The fact pattern is tragically predictable – the Jeep is struck in the rear, the plastic gas tank ruptures, gasoline spills, and a spark from the impact lights the gasoline on fire.
